아이디어에서 작동하는 앱까지
프롬프트 전에 계획하고, frontend 우선 또는 back-to-front 빌드를 선택하고, 디버깅에 Plan mode를 사용하고, 실제 사용자와 검증하세요.
"뭘 하는지 전혀 모르겠어... 하지만 무엇을 빌드하고 싶은지는 정확히 알아."
이것이 당신의 이야기라면, 올바른 곳에 왔습니다.
이 가이드의 대상
당신은 아이디어가 있습니다.
AI 도구를 사용해 봤고, 메모를 작성했고, 몇 개의 프로젝트를 열어봤을 수도 있습니다.
하지만 영감과 실행 사이에서 막혀 있습니다.
이 가이드는 다음에 도움이 됩니다:
- 모호한 개념에서 구체적인 제품으로
- 일반적인 실수 피하기
- Lovable을 스마트하게 사용하기 — 특히 개발자가 아닌 경우
일반적인 함정: 계획 전에 빌드하기
많은 사용자가 같은 함정에 빠집니다: 무엇을 빌드하는지 명확히 하기 전에 빌드를 시작합니다.
결과는?
- 오류 위에 오류
- 혼란스러운 AI 에이전트와 AI 생성 오류
- 방향을 벗어나거나 "
고치기엔 너무 멀리 간" 느낌의 프로젝트
아이디어를 실제 제품으로 전환하기 위한 모범 사례
1. Lovable 외부에서 시작하기
라이브스트림 게스트 MP를 포함한 많은 빌더들이 Lovable을 열기 전에 아이디어를 구체화하는 데 시간을 보냅니다.
이것을 시도하세요:
- 아이디어를 자연스럽게 설명하는 음성 메모 녹음하기 (MP는 Granola를 사용)
- GPT나 Claude에 붙여넣어 명확한 제품 용어로 확장된 버전 얻기
- AI에게 디자이너, PM 또는 개발자 역할을 맡아 PRD(제품 요구 사항 문서)를 비평하거나 공동 작성하도록 요청하기
명확한 비전에서 작동하는 프로토타입으로 갈 준비가 되었을 때 Lovable을 사용하세요.
2. 먼저 작성하기
AI에 프롬프트하기 전에 15분을 들여 작성하세요:
- 제품이 무엇을 하는가?
- 누구를 위한 것인가 (당신만을 위한 것이더라도)
- 가장 단순하고 최소한의 버전에 포함되어야 할 것
이것을 기능이나 사용 사례 목록으로 전환하세요:
사용자 스토리나 기능 목록으로 작성하고 Plan mode나 GPT에 입력하여 PRD(제품 요구 사항 문서)를 얻으세요.
3. 빌드 스타일을 현명하게 선택하기
Lovable로 빌드하는 데 두 가지 유효한 접근 방식이 있습니다:
- Frontend 우선 (초보자에게 권장)
- 목 데이터로 시작
- 데이터베이스 연결 없이 레이아웃, 흐름, 로직 빌드
- 만족하면 Lovable Cloud 또는 Supabase를 연결하고 라이브로 전환
- Back-to-front:
- 1일차부터 Lovable Cloud 또는 Supabase 연결
- 각 기능을 하나씩 빌드하고 테스트
- 디버깅에 익숙한 고급 사용자에게 가장 적합
초보자라면 frontend 우선을 선택하세요. 다음을 할 수 있습니다:
- 복잡한 SQL 오류 피하기
- 더 빠르게 반복
- 디자인 + 사용성에 집중
MP는 속도, 명확성, 디버깅 용이성을 위해 frontend 우선을 사용했습니다. 빠르게 배우고 더 빨리 배포하는 데 도움이 되었습니다.
4. Plan mode를 사고 파트너로 사용하기
Plan mode는 단순한 챗봇이 아닙니다 — 프로젝트를 인식하는 어시스턴트입니다.
파일, 데이터베이스 스키마, 로그를 알고 있습니다.
다음에 사용하세요:
- 컨텍스트와 함께 문제 디버그
- 모호한 아이디어를 구조화된 컴포넌트로 분해
- 브레인스토밍, 계획, 반복
- 모호한 아이디어를 작동하는 흐름으로 변환
이 프롬프트를 시도하세요:
개 번식 관리 앱을 빌드하고 싶습니다. 다음을 수행해야 합니다: [목록]. 빌드할 단계나 컴포넌트로 분해해 주시겠어요?
잡 코칭 앱을 빌드하고 있습니다. 다음을 수행하길 원합니다: [목록]. 테스트할 가장 간단한 버전은 무엇인가요?5. 브릭으로 분해하기
모든 것을 한 번에 빌드하지 마세요. 아이디어를 브릭으로 분할하세요:
- 각 브릭 = 하나의 기능, 컴포넌트 또는 흐름
- 한 번에 하나씩 빌드
- 테스트, 개선, 그 다음으로 이동
다음과 같은 프롬프트로 Plan mode에게 계획을 도와달라고 요청하세요:
여기 제 앱 아이디어가 있습니다. 빌드해야 할 기능이나 단계로 분해해 주시겠어요?이 아이디어를 한 번에 하나씩 테스트할 수 있는 빌드 가능한 기능으로 분해해 주세요.6. 목적을 가지고 프롬프팅하기
각 프롬프트 전에 물어보세요:
지금 무엇을 빌드하려고 하는가?구체적으로 하세요. 대화 중간에 전환을 피하세요 — AI가 제대로 도와주려면 일관된 의도가 필요합니다.
7. 무한 오류 루프 피하기
막혔나요? "Try to Fix"를 10번 클릭하지 마세요.
대신:
- 브라우저 dev tools 열기 (Console 탭)
- 실제 오류 복사
- Plan mode에 붙여넣어 조사
- 또는 데이터베이스 없이 프로젝트를 리믹스하여 디버깅 단순화
Lovable은 이제 자동으로 콘솔 로그를 읽습니다 — 대부분의 경우 복사-붙여넣기가 필요 없습니다.
8. 지저분해지면 리믹스하기
프로젝트는 진화합니다. 엉켜있는 느낌이 든다면:
- 프로젝트 리믹스 (프로젝트를 복제하고 원본은 유지)
- 배운 것으로 새로 시작
- 새 빌드를 집중적이고 구조화되게 유지
- 작동하는 것은 유지. 그렇지 않은 것은 버리기.
9. 빠른 실제 검증 사용하기
한 사용자가 판매를 위해 빌드하지 않았다고 말했습니다. DM으로 10명의 사용자에게 러프 프로토타입을 보냈습니다. 한 명이 즉시 결제하겠다고 요청했습니다. 금요일까지 Stripe가 통합되었습니다.
다음으로 검증하세요:
- 실제 사용자에게 "이것이 도움이 될까요?"라고 물어보기
- 완벽함이 아닌 빠른 피드백 받기
- 실제 관심이 다음 단계를 안내하도록 하기
10. 나쁜 아이디어를 빌드하면서 더 나아지기
MP는 100개 이상의 일회용 프로젝트를 빌드했습니다:
- 낯선 사람에게 메시지 앱
- 90년대 향수 생성기
- AI 인터뷰 준비 도구
각각은 기술을 테스트하는 데 도움이 되었습니다:
- backend 없이 UI 빌드하기
- 비속어 필터 추가하기
- AI API 연결하기
- 사용자 흐름 관리하기
교훈:
존재할 필요가 없는 것을 빌드하세요 — 그래서 무언가가 필요할 때 준비되어 있습니다.
빌더 체크리스트
- 아이디어를 5-10개 글머리 기호로 작성
- MVP(최소 실행 가능 제품)의 핵심 기능 나열 (글머리 기호 사용)
- 결정: Frontend 우선 또는 back-to-front
- Plan mode를 사용하여 공동 계획 및 디버그
- 브릭으로 빌드: 한 번에 1개 기능
- 준비가 되었을 때만 backend 연결
- 오류가 쌓이면 리믹스
- 라이브 전에 피드백 받기
마지막 팁: 당신이 첫 번째 사용자입니다
- 먼저 자신을 위해 디자인하세요.
- 미래 사용자처럼 테스트하세요.
- 제품 디자이너처럼 생각하세요.
그리고 기억하세요: 당신만이 상상할 수 있는 것을 빌드하고 있습니다.
코딩하는 방법을 알 필요가 없습니다.
명확한 아이디어, 좋은 계획, 약간의 인내심만 있으면 됩니다.
Lovable이 나머지를 도와줄 것입니다.